We advocate that the dual picture of spacetime noncommutativity , i.e. the existence of a curved momentum space, could be a way out to solve some of the open conceptual problems in the field, such as the basis dependence of observables. In this framework, we show how to build deformed Klein--Gordon and Dirac equations. In addition, we give an outlook of how one could define quantum field theories, both free and interacting ones.
